This is exactly the thing. In UK electricity price is set by the cost of generating it from natural gas. After losses, etc, you get about 1/3 of power in electricity compared to heat in the gas. And the heat pump has an efficiency factor of about 3. So you get back to unity.
While electricity is priced off gas, current heat pumps do not have a strong economic case.

Many comments here focusing on secrets and problems. But here is another way to look at this:
Environment variables are the "indefinite scope and dynamic extent" variable bindings to make structured programs out of Unix processes. To compare them to a text file is like writing that a program needs no variables because it can read all the values it needs from an input data file when it needs them.
Environment variables are precisely to be used in situation where sub-processes need to be passed information in a way that is not necessarily affecting subsequent calls to that subprocess from another section of a program. Sometime the subprocesses are sequences of nested shells, and sometimes other more complex programs, but the same idea applies.

Its great for when people need to be in the loop, looking at the data, maybe loading in Excel etc. (I use it myself...). But not enough humans around for 21 GB/s
Yes, but if you have decades of data, what turns on having to wait for a minute or 10 minutes to convert it?
I think these would add only small amount of information (and in a DB would be modelled as joins). Only adds lots of data if done very inefficiently.
Humans generate decisions / text information at rates of ~bytes per second at most. There is barely enough humans around to generate 21GB/s of information even if all they did was make financial decisions!
So 21 GB/s would be solely algos talking to algos... Given all the investment in the algos, surely they don't need to be exchanging CSV around?

Big rail supporter here, but the HS2 project execution lost all sense of cost. For context the, the total receipts from all passenger rail in UK are around £10b (https://dataportal.orr.gov.uk/statistics/usage/passenger-rai...). For a single new line to require a £100bn investment, i.e., 10x of total gross receipts of the entire industry, is just disproportionate.
